
“Let Fruit Flow”
Beloved, fruit is not something you force—it’s something that is produced through connection. Too often, we try to manufacture what only God can grow. However, when you stay rooted in Christ, what He places in you will naturally begin to flow through you.
Because of this, Jesus says in John 15:8, “Bear much fruit.” In other words, fruit is the evidence of a life that is connected to Him. And as you continue in that connection, Galatians 5:22–23 describes what that fruit looks like: “love, joy, peace, patience…” These are not traits you have to strive to create—they are the result of His Spirit working within you.
Now, even with that truth, it can be easy to fall into striving. You may find yourself trying harder to be more patient, more loving, or more at peace. Yet, the more you strive in your own strength, the more frustrated you may become. That’s because fruit is not produced by effort alone—it is produced by abiding.
Therefore, your responsibility is not to force the fruit—
it is to remain connected to the source.
As you stay connected, God begins to shape your heart. He softens what was once hardened, strengthens what was once weak, and grows what was once lacking. And over time, what He is doing in you becomes evident through you—because when you are rooted in Him,growth becomes natural.
For this reason, you don’t have to compare your journey to others. You don’t have to rush the process or question the pace. God is intentional with how He grows you, and His timing is always right.
So instead of striving, remain.
Instead of forcing, trust.
Instead of worrying, abide—because when you stay rooted, the fruit will flow.
So Beloved, stay connected—and let God do the growing.
